Job Description

hatch I.T. is partnering with Via to find a Senior Software Developer. See details below:

About the Role:

An impressive mission requires an equally impressive Senior Software Developer.

As a key technical contributor at VIA, you will be instrumental in architecting and constructing the pioneering, secure, and scalable software that underpins VIA's mission. You will directly influence how critical data is protected and shared, leveraging our advanced Web3, quantum-resistant technologies.

This role offers a chance to significantly contribute by creating high-quality, secure software and tackling intricate data problems for individuals who are driven by innovation and dedicated to excellence.

In this role, you will:

  • Architect and implement secure, reliable, and scalable microservices, applying deep understanding of software architecture principles and best practices.
  • Integrate VIA’s Web3 components and privacy-preserving technologies to deliver cutting-edge features and innovative platform functionality.
  • Define, document, and drive adoption of end-to-end software development lifecycle (SDLC) processes, ensuring clarity and efficiency from initial concept through deployment and maintenance.
  • Spearhead the creation, development, and optimization of automation pipelines for continuous integration, testing, and deployment (CI/CD), ensuring efficient and reliable application releases.
  • Develop and execute comprehensive automated testing strategies, including unit and integration tests, to deliver high-quality, robust software.
  • Proactively monitor, troubleshoot, analyze, and optimize the performance of deployed applications, working to mitigate bottlenecks.
  • Serve as a subject matter expert and provide technical leadership in privacy and security, guiding project delivery and ensuring VIA’s solutions meet the highest standards.
  • Clearly articulate complex software designs, architectural choices, and technical processes to diverse audiences, including technical peers and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Collaborate effectively with various cross-functional teams to ensure alignment, solve problems, and achieve successful project outcomes.
  • Rapidly grasp new technical concepts and effectively apply this knowledge to address complex challenges and develop innovative solutions that meet customer needs.
  • Continuously explore and thoughtfully integrate relevant advancements in privacy, cryptography, and distributed systems to contribute to VIA's cutting-edge products.

What you will bring to this role:

  • Bachelor’s degree or higher in computer science, mathematics, engineering, or science
  • 5+ years of relevant full stack or backend development experience
  • Strong experience with cloud-based software development in a microservices environment and cryptography techniques, including:
  • Developing RESTful APIs (using frameworks such as FastAPI) secured by OAuth2/Auth
  • Integrating asymmetric and/or symmetric encryption in applications
  • Thorough working knowledge of data structures, algorithms, databases (SQL and NoSQL), and in-memory data storage
  • Extensive knowledge of parallel processing, message brokers, and/or distributed task queues
  • Working knowledge of Docker containers
  • Previous experience leading an Agile team of developers a plus:
  • Proven on-time delivery of multiple quality software projects
  • Ability to advocate for technical excellence, maintaining the highest standard of software engineering practices
  • Model an ability to identify blockers and use critical thinking to provide creative solutions
  • Proficiency in documentation and the desire to clearly communicate technical processes to both non-technical and technical audiences.
  • Exposure to the following a plus: IETF RFCs, blockchain systems, zero-knowledge proofs
  • Service mesh (Istio), zero trust architecture and observability
  • Working knowledge of Helm charts
